Kamloops & District Chamber of Commerce Announces Nominees for the 38th Annual Business Excellence Awards Presented by MNP LLP 

A record breaking 730+ nominations were received from the public!

Kamloops, BC – June 14, 2024 – The Kamloops & District Chamber of Commerce is thrilled to announce the nominees for the 38th annual Business Excellence Awards, proudly presented by MNP LLP. This year, we are celebrating a record-breaking achievement with over 730 nominations from the public, recognizing over 130 unique businesses in the Kamloops region. 

Among these outstanding nominations, the Chamber received over 80 nominations for both the Emerging Business of the Year Award and the Business Person of the Year Award. The Chamber is also excited to announce that we received over 100 nominations for the Small Business of the Year Award. This extraordinary level of community engagement highlights the vibrant and dynamic business landscape in Kamloops.

The Kamloops & District Chamber of Commerce is excited to celebrate these exceptional businesses. The Chamber hosted a nominee celebration on June 14 at Moccasin Square Garden. On Thursday, July 25, all Finalists will be announced at the Finalists Announcement presented by Digital Convergence. Winners will be announced at the Business Excellence Awards Gala on Thursday, October 24.
